Output 422a79e57289c6ec42d7f2f9e8c7a3eb6319b6df4e91ebe8243aa423ce9ba22b:0

value
135896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a0e577de8117b6a1c640bbfba3534595de36df7 OP_EQUAL
address
3HCBydyESgahs6iLdMfsaDNZwby5XBfawE
transaction
422a79e57289c6ec42d7f2f9e8c7a3eb6319b6df4e91ebe8243aa423ce9ba22b
spent
true